- The distance between Balakot, Pakistan and Rockhampton, Queensland, Australia is approximately 10,360 km or 6,438 mi.
- To reach Balakot in this distance one would set out from Rockhampton, Queensland bearing 306.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Balakot bearing 296.3° or WNW .
-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Balakot is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Rockhampton, Queensland is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 4.4 °C (8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10 °C (18°F) more in Balakot.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 907.9 mm (35.7 in) more which is equivalent to 907.9 l/m² (22.28 US gal/ft²) or 9,079,000 l/ha (970,605 US gal/ac) more. About 2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.1° lower in Balakot than in Rockhampton, Queensland.
